On draft at Dram and Draught Greensboro. This was great stuff. Pours opaque dark brown/black color with a small dense khaki head. Nice head retention and soapy lacing down the glass. Aromas and flavors of big dark chocolate, cocoa, coffee, dark bread, nuts, smoke, char, pine, wood, herbal, grass, pepper. Light dark fruit and citrus. Moderate pine, char, woody, peppery bitterness on the finish. Medium carbonation and body. Creamy/ bready malts. Some sticky hops and chalky roast. Light-moderate increasing hop/char bitter drying with no acrid/astringency. Spot on American style porter. No complaints.

Standard look for a porter. Very dark, opaque brown with minimal carbonation and thus, not much in the way of head. Just a small brown cap. Smell is very nice. Malt and chocolate, sweet yet substantial. Taste picks up that combo and improves on it. It's rich, hearty, and leans to the dark side, as I like in my porters. Mouthfeel is nice and full. They are a bit too heavy on the roasty bitterness as the back end comes around, but overall, this is a fine beer. My best from Hoots so far.
